A 73-year-old man was confirmed dead this weekend after falling overboard on a Disney Cruise Line from Australia to New Zealand.

The victim vanished from the Disney Wonder at around 4.30 a.m. on Saturday, prompting an extensive search and rescue operation.

The rescue team’s efforts, which included the use of thermal imaging and surveillance cameras, lasted for more than five hours but were unsuccessful in locating the missing man, whose identity has not been released.

In response to the emergency, the Disney Wonder, which had departed Melbourne on November 20 for a five-day journey to Auckland, turned around to scour the area, meaning the ship is now expected to arrive in New Zealand a day later than scheduled.
